A non-admin user's attempt at impersonation would be successful ifthe user is part of the OOTB impersonator group.
Impersonation in AEM: Impersonation allows one user to assume the identity of another user. This feature is useful for troubleshooting and testing user permissions.
OOTB Impersonator Group: The out-of-the-box (OOTB) impersonator group in AEM includes users who have been granted the rights to impersonate other users.
Permissions and Group Membership: Being part of the impersonator group is necessary for successful impersonation as it provides the required permissions.
